Next week as a special Halloween treat we will see two of Irelands top dance music producers get behind the decks in Wax to knock all your tiny socks off!!

These two have been on the Irish dance scene for over 10 years now and have a wealth of experience in the area of making people dance, that no-one else has quite mastered, bar these two.

Hailing from letterkenny, Timmy and Tommy have been involved in everything from club promoting,to running their own pirate radio station, to appearing as regular guests on RTE 2 Fm.

Also being two of the major heads behind dancemusicireland.com, Timmy and Tommy never see a days work over, which is the work you also see in their own productions, which have been picking up some international acclaim with their track 'Full Tiltin', which has had plays from some from the biggest international djs.

Time For Porty!!

Chemistry Celebrates It's First Birthday Dangerously!!






The time has finally come for Chemistry to celebrate its first birthday on September 24th!

We've come a long way for what started out in humble beginnings as a small monthly operation in Citi Bar… and who could have predicted that it would have grown into what it is now?

Chemistry booked, Feadz of Ed Banger Records, for its first major act in Wax on the 14th of November last year. Unsurprisingly, Feadz blew the faces off everyone who jammed their gyrating limbs into the club. 

At the end of January 2008 Chemistry expanded its horizons from just the basement of Wax to include the venue of Spy and divided its music interests accordingly, by adding two by-monthly indie resident DJs to man (and woman) the decks upstairs.

Since then, there has been a steady flow of acts from both home and abroad including: Deadbots, Teenage Bad Girl, Sourcecode, DatA, Mr Myagi, Hystereo and Kavinsky. Add to that a weekly turn out of over 600 people, and it looks like Chemisty will be around to see itself through another few birthday celebrations…

Danger

Danger is one of newest entries to to hit the quality french label Ekler'o'oshock which counts the likes of DatATerry Poison and Chewy Chocolate Cookies, in its ranks.

Only 23 years old , 'Danger' (real name Frank Rivoire), being both illustrator and graphic designer in training, is one of the brightest newcomers on the Electro scene.

His first E.P. , named simply E.P. I, was released in late 2007 featuring heavy electro etudes like '19H11' , '14H54'  and '11H30' (also including a remix by fellow Ekler'o'shock artist DatA for 11H30). With the impending release of his much awaited second E.P., Danger is set to climb the ranks of the Electro scene even further.

His catalogue of remixes stretch further than the dance scene alone, He's completed remixes for 
Kanye West - ('American Boy'), We are scientists ('Chick Lit') and his current masterpiece is an unbelieveable remix of the French entry to the Eurovision song contest, 'Divine' by Sebastien Tellier.
